Honey for a Child's Heart
This is an essential guide for parents who are looking for the best books for children, and who want to incorporate reading as a major part of their family life. It includes everything from advice on what makes a good book to the long-term benefits of reading. The author also includes a list of the best books for children ages 0-14, including classics, as well as new books on the market.
